数据库 · 10 11 月, 2024

實現高效管理:數據庫與軟件共存一體的單台伺服器 (數據庫和軟件在一台伺服器上)

實現高效管理:數據庫與軟件共存一體的單台伺服器

在當今數據驅動的世界中,企業對於數據的管理和應用越來越依賴。隨著技術的進步,許多企業選擇在單台伺服器上同時運行數據庫和應用程序,以提高效率和降低成本。這種架構不僅能夠簡化管理流程,還能提升系統的整體性能。

單台伺服器架構的優勢

將數據庫和應用程序部署在同一台伺服器上,具有多方面的優勢:

  • 成本效益:使用單台伺服器可以減少硬件和維護成本,特別是對於中小型企業來說,這是一個重要的考量。
  • 簡化管理:在同一台伺服器上運行數據庫和應用程序,可以減少管理的複雜性,降低人力資源的需求。
  • 提高性能:數據庫和應用程序之間的通信延遲會減少,從而提高整體性能。

實現數據庫與軟件共存的技術考量

在設計一個能夠支持數據庫和應用程序共存的伺服器架構時,有幾個技術要素需要考慮:

1. 硬件配置

選擇合適的硬件配置是確保系統穩定運行的關鍵。通常,建議選擇具備足夠內存和處理能力的伺服器,以支持同時運行的數據庫和應用程序。例如,對於中小型應用,至少需要8GB的RAM和四核處理器。

2. 數據庫選擇

根據應用需求選擇合適的數據庫系統。常見的選擇包括MySQL、PostgreSQL和SQLite等。這些數據庫系統各有優缺點,企業應根據實際需求進行選擇。

3. 軟件架構

在設計應用程序時,應考慮到數據庫的性能需求。使用高效的查詢語言和優化的數據結構,可以顯著提高數據庫的響應速度。例如,使用索引來加速查詢,或是將頻繁訪問的數據緩存到內存中。

實施步驟

實現數據庫與軟件共存的過程可以分為幾個步驟:

  1. 需求分析:確定應用程序的功能需求和數據庫的性能需求。
  2. 硬件選擇:根據需求選擇合適的伺服器硬件。
  3. 安裝操作系統:選擇穩定的操作系統,如Linux或Windows Server。
  4. 安裝數據庫:根據選擇的數據庫系統進行安裝和配置。
  5. 部署應用程序:將應用程序部署到伺服器上,並進行必要的配置。
  6. 性能測試:進行性能測試,確保系統能夠穩定運行。

結論

在單台伺服器上實現數據庫與軟件的共存,不僅能夠提高管理效率,還能降低運營成本。隨著技術的發展,這種架構將會越來越受到企業的青睞。對於希望在香港尋找高效能解決方案的企業來說,選擇合適的 VPS 服務將是實現這一目標的重要一步。